Which individual is personally trying to influence public policy?
A.
Kenneth wants to hear other people's opinions regarding political matters, so he always brings up politics in social settings.
B.
Greg makes sure that he reads about a news story from several different sources because he wants to avoid bias.
C.
Jan does not want a new grocery store to be built in her community, so she goes door-to-door for signatures from others who feel the same way.
D.
Jasmine will only vote in local elections if there is a candidate that shares her exact beliefs and ideals
C
Explanation:
Jan is personally trying to influence public policy, by personally going door-to-door for signatures she is influencing her community regarding public policy, in this case the prospect of a new grocery store.

both are true, the congress does have the power to create banks, even if this power is not specifically described in the constitution, since there is nothing restricting it and there is power given to the congress to make "all laws which shall be necessary and proper". maryland was not allowed to tax a branch of the national bank operating there, and the supreme court decided that no state could. both of these topics were discussed in a decision of the mcculloch v. maryland case in 1819.
